¿Cómo extraigo valores de entrada con el mismo nombre en un servlet? [duplicar]

Esta pregunta ya tiene una respuesta aquí:

¿Cómo obtener múltiples valores seleccionados del cuadro de selección en JSP? 4 respuestas

Tengo un formulario que contiene varios valores de productID. Están contenidos en un texto de entrada, con diferentes valores, todos con el mismo nombre.

<%
ListIterator ul2 = myCartList3.listIterator(); 
while(ul2.hasNext()){ 
    ShoppingCart myCart2 = new ShoppingCart();
    myCart2 = (ShoppingCart)ul2.next();
%>
<input type="text" value="<%=myCart2.getProductID() %>" name="productID"   size="3" />
<% 
} 
%>

Cuando se envía el formulario, va al servlet. Usualmente usaríarequest.getParameter pero solo muestra un atributo. ¿Cómo recupero múltiples atributos con el mismo nombre?

Respuestas a la pregunta(2)

Su respuesta a la pregunta